The Rise of Drone Technology in Delivery Services
A Brief Historical Context
The concept of using drones for deliveries originated from military applications, where un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s) were primarily used for surveillance and reconnaissance. However, over the years, advancements in technology have paved the way for civilian applications of drones, especially in logistics and delivery services.
In 2013, Amazon made headlines when CEO Jeff Bezos unveiled the Prime Air program, aiming to deliver packages via drones within 30 minutes. Fast forward to 2024, and various companies are successfully implementing drone deliveries, showcasing significant improvements in speed, efficiency, and safety.

Understanding AI-Driven Decision Making in Drones
The Role of AI in Drone Navigation
AI technology serves as the brain behind drones, enabling them to analyze vast amounts of data from various sensors to make decisions in real-time. Drones equipped with AI systems use machine learning algorithms that learned from previous delivery experiences, optimizing their routes, and drop-off points based on historical trends and environmental factors.
The integration of GPS, cameras, and obstacle detection systems allows these drones to accurately assess their surroundings. Some of the critical elements involved in determining optimal drop-off points include:
- Data Collection: Drones gather data about traffic patterns, weather conditions, and geographical features.
- Path Optimization: AI algorithms process the data to develop the most efficient flight paths, considering both distance and potential obstacles.
- Dynamic Adjustments: Real-time adjustments are made based on changing environmental circumstances, allowing drones to avoid congested areas or inclement weather.
Algorithms at Work
The effectiveness of AI in identifying optimal drop-off points is largely attributed to the algorithms employed in the drone technology. These algorithms can engage in predictive analytics, learning from historical delivery data, and refining themselves over successive deliveries.
Key approaches employed include:
- Reinforcement Learning: Drones can learn from trial and error experiences, improving their functionality with each delivery.
- Predictive Modeling: Algorithms use data to forecast traffic conditions, helping predict the best drop-off points based on expected delays or hazards.
The combination of these advanced practices makes AI-driven drones exceptionally efficient, ensuring timely and safe deliveries.

Diverse Sector Utilization
Different sectors are beginning to harness the potential of AI-driven drones, with applications ranging across healthcare with timely medical supply deliveries to food industries ensuring hot meals reach customers without delay. Some notable examples include:
- Healthcare Delivery: Drones are used to transport essential medical supplies, especially in remote areas. By optimizing drop-off points to local clinics, drones ensure life-saving medications arrive promptly.
- Retail Sector: Retailers are increasingly adopting drones for last-mile logistics, providing customers with speedier service. AI-driven algorithms optimize delivery routes and drop-off spots based on the customer's location and local conditions.
- Emergency Services: Drones are now being utilized in logistics during emergencies, such as delivering supplies or equipment to inaccessible locations.

The Future of AI and Drone Deliveries
Emerging Trends
The future of drone delivery looks bright and full of potential. With the continual evolution of drone technology and AI, we can anticipate several key developments:
- Scalability of Drone Operations: As technology advances, we’ll likely see an increase in the payload capacity of drones, enabling the transportation of larger items.
- Regulatory Changes: With governments becoming more familiar with drone operations and legislation, more accessible regulations could pave the way for broader acceptance and use of these technologies.
- Urban Air Mobility: Initiatives aimed at creating urban air corridors for drones will significantly alter logistics landscapes in densely populated areas.

Are there any restrictions on drone deliveries?
Yes, various regulations govern the use of drones for delivery services. These regulations may vary by country and region, addressing aspects such as airspace usage, altitude restrictions, and safety protocols.
